Permits & the Bell v. Wells rule
Moody Beach's dry sand is privately owned to the mean low-water mark. Any ceremony with chairs, arches, amplified sound, or a real guest count needs a Town of Wells Special Event Permit — file 30+ days ahead.
Best ceremony spots
Wells Beach (public), Drakes Island, Wells Harbor Community Park, and private oceanfront rentals on Ocean Ave. For truly on-Moody ceremonies, work with a host who allows events.
When to get married on the coast
Peak: late June – mid September (books 6–12 months ahead). Locals' favorite: mid-May to mid-June and mid-September to early October — softer light, better rates, empty sand.
Tides matter
Time your ceremony to low or mid-outgoing tide so guests aren't backed against dunes. Our tide widget and NOAA station 8419317 (Wells) give exact times.
Golden hour on Moody
For photos, the light off Moody Beach lands hardest in the last 90 minutes before sunset. Sunrise on the eastern-facing sand is the quiet-elopement alternative.
Small & intimate friendly
Most locals-hosted rentals allow immediate-family ceremonies (typically ≤20 guests). Larger receptions usually move to Ogunquit venues — we can point you at partners.
